We’re looking to hire a junior to mid-level candidate to join out GPU Architecture team at Arm in Austin, TX.
The ideal candidate will have:
* A strong understanding of GPU architecture
* Experience modeling new architectural features in a large C++ codebase
* Working knowledge of compiler technology, with the ability to make small compiler changes and validate them through testing

The Central Technology Team within Arm develops key technologies which will form the foundation of future products.
You will join a multinational, collaborative and highly motivated Graphics Hardware Architecture team in Central Technology to help craft the direction of our world leading Mali™ Graphics products. The Mali™ Graphics Processor is the #1 shipping GPU.
What you could be doing as a Graduate GPU Modeling and Compiler Engineer?
Your job responsibilities will be diverse including architecture, technology research, hands-on prototyping, experimental investigations, engaging with product groups, and working closely together with the engineering team to deliver premier IP.
You can expect to work with leading GPU Architects to prototype architectural improvements in the GPU, validate and propose innovative architecture ideas. Your work will make a difference and enable Arm to deliver industry leading future GPU IPs for generations!
We are looking for individuals who:
Hold (or are on track to hold) a PhD degree or equivalent experience in Computer Science, Computer or Electrical Engineering before September 2026. Candidates with alternative degrees, such as a Masters, will also be considered with relevant industry experience.
